Virginia Representative, Christian, Refuses To Apologize For Anti-Muslim Remarks

December 21, 2006
Shaveta Bansal
Staff Writer (AHN)


Washington, D.C. (AHN) - "Rep. Virgil Goode (R-VA) has reportedly refused to apologize for the anti-Muslim remarks he made in a recent letter sent to the 5th District constituents. In the letter, which the Council on American-Islamic Relations labeled as "Islamophobic," the outspoken Congressman denounced the surge in the American Muslim community."
In the letter Goode wrote, "I do not subscribe to using the Quran in any way.

"The Muslim Representative from Minnesota was elected by the voters of that district and if American citizens don't wake up and adopt the Virgil Goode position on immigration there will likely be many more Muslims elected to office and demanding the use of the Koran."

The Congressman further wrote, "I fear that in the next century we will have many more Muslims in the United States if we do not adopt the strict immigration policies that I believe are necessary to preserve the values and beliefs traditional to the United States of America."
